Frequently Asked Questions about Lemon Grove
How much are Studio apartments in Lemon Grove?
There are currently 321 Studio Apartments in Lemon Grove with rent ranges from $850 to $2,435 with an average price of $1,867.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Lemon Grove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Lemon Grove ranges from $1,400 to $4,945 with an average monthly rent of $2,191.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Lemon Grove c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Lemon Grove range from $1,925 to $9,161.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,731.
How expensive are Lemon Grove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 224 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Lemon Grove on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,500 to $12,077 - averaging $4,343 for the location.
